ITPub博客

首页 > 数据库 > Oracle > aaa

aaa

原创 Oracle 作者:juan025 时间:2019-06-26 08:39:04 0 删除 编辑
        再次验证了exists对性能的影响
        对OR表达式的理解要深刻
      批判
        物化视图的使用,是否可以在鉴权功能方案期间就需要设计?因为这个鉴权在很多地方都有用到
        模块化后带来了责任人不明确的弊端,公共模块提供统一接口,而当子模块调用出现性能问题时,公共模块又不愿意修改
    6.物料状态查询(大象堵住了蚂蚁窝)
      案例
        现象
          在物料状态配置界面出现了严重的性能瓶颈,甚至卡死
          页面的数据来自两个数据源:OARCLE+HANA
          已经定位是hana获取数据慢,而事实上,从只从hana获取物料描述单一信息
        分析
          物料状态只是配置数据,数据量有限,即便全查出来也不应该出现性能问题
          拿到SQL时,发现是个“水桶腰”,而且洋洋洒洒几十行
          这个SQL与我预期的SQL相去甚远,因为单一的物料描述应该只来自一两个表而已
          从最外层的物料描述字段跟踪,发现这个字段来自一个子查询
          这个子查询里面包含了页面所要提取的所有字段
          在其他的子查询中,还包含了聚合函数,这些表都是库存表,数据量大得惊人,都是10亿+
        方案

来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/693533/viewspace-1985237/,如需转载,请注明出处,否则将追究法律责任。

上一篇: aaa
下一篇: aaa
请登录后发表评论 登录
全部评论

注册时间:2019-02-13

  • 博文量
    26
  • 访问量
    20482